Description:
1H-Indole-3-butanoic acid, α-(acetylamino)-, with the CAS number 205813-00-9, is a chemical compound that belongs to the class of indole derivatives. It features an indole ring, which is a bicyclic structure composed of a six-membered benzene ring fused to a five-membered nitrogen-containing pyrrole ring. The compound is characterized by the presence of a butanoic acid side chain and an acetylamino group, which contributes to its potential biological activity. This compound may exhibit properties relevant to plant growth regulation, as indole derivatives are often associated with auxin activity, influencing processes such as cell elongation and division. Additionally, the acetylamino substitution can enhance solubility and bioavailability. The compound's structure suggests it may participate in various chemical reactions, including acylation and amide formation, making it of interest in synthetic organic chemistry and potential pharmaceutical applications. As with many indole derivatives, it may also exhibit interesting pharmacological properties, warranting further investigation into its biological effects and mechanisms of action.
Formula:C14H16N2O3
Synonyms:- α-Acetamido--(3-indole)-butyric Acid
